Simple eligibility checklist

Small Business Loan Eligibility Criteria

The requirements for getting an unsecured business loan in Auckland of between $5K to $100K are quite minimal.

  • Minimum of 6 months in business
  • A minimum of $6,000 in revenue per month
  • Be a New Zealand based business with a New Zealand Business Number (NZBN)
  • Passport or Driver’s Licence for proof of identity
  • Make sure you have a New Zealand bank as your main trading account
  • Bank statements from the previous six months

Is the Larger Business Loan one that requires security?

Asset security is needed for accessing funds over $150,000. It’s in the form of a charge on assets, and may include the registration of this on the PPSR or filing as a caveat.

A personal or director’s ensure is a promise to pay back a loan that is general in nature, rather than stipulating the security for a particular asset. The person who is signing the ensure is personally responsible if the company creditor is unable to make the repayment.

The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is an online, central register run by the New Zealand Government. It contains security interests granted to individuals who own personal property (including items or assets). The PPSR gives prioritisation over property that is personal to be assigned in accordance with the date on which a security interest that is registered.

The caveat can be described as a formal document lodged to provide the legal claim on a property.

About business loans

What exactly is an asset-based loan (a secured loan)?

Asset-based borrowing is when an company owner utilises the assets they have to get the funding. The asset may be a personal asset like the family home or an business asset such as a vehicle as well as a piece of machine.

The majority of banks, even the largest banks, are inclined to make loans secured by an asset. If you are having difficulty paying back the loan, then the asset might be offered for sale by the lender. In essence, it’s the process of securing new funding using the value of what you already have.
